Spencer, IA (KICD)– It is a special weekend for the Clay County Heritage Center.

Director Braden Falline says there’s also a new display at the Visitor’s Center on Grand Avenue.

The open House at the Parker Museum runs 1 until 4 Sunday. The address is 300 East 3rd Street in Spencer. The Heritage and Century Farms of Clay County display runs through January 23rd at the Visitor Center.
